In vitro secretion profile of pro‐inflammatory cytokines IL‐1β, TNF‐α, IL‐6, and of human beta‐defensins (HBD)‐1, HBD‐2, and HBD‐3 from human chorioamniotic membranes after selective stimulation with Gardnerella vaginalis. Am J Reprod Immunol 2012; 67: 34–43 Problem Preterm labor associated with infection is a major clinical condition; in this work, we analyze the response of human chorioamniotic membranes stimulated with Gardnerella vaginalis. Method of study Using a two‐compartment experimental model, 1 × 106 CFU/mL of G. vaginalis were added to either the amnion or choriodecidua face or to both. Concentrations of IL‐1β, TNF‐α, and IL‐6, as well as human beta defensins (HBD) 1‐3 were quantified by ELISA. Results In comparison with control conditions and regardless of the stimulation modality, IL‐1β and IL‐6 increased 4‐fold and 28‐fold, respectively, in the choriodecidual compartment. HBD‐1 increased 2‐fold mainly in the amniotic compartment when the stimulus was applied directly to this region. HBD‐2 and HBD‐3 increased an average of 2‐ and 8‐fold, respectively, in the choriodecidual region. Conclusions Stimulation with G. vaginalis induced a tissue‐specific secretion profile of 1L‐1β, IL‐6, and HBD 1‐3 in the chorioamniotic membranes.
